About Bessemer
If you're seeking a genuinely affordable Southern lifestyle, Bessemer, Alabama, is calling. With a population just shy of 26,000, Bessemer offers a close-knit community feel without sacrificing access to amenities. The real draw? The price of entry. You'll find the median home value here hovers around a remarkable $118,600, a stark contrast to the national average. This translates to more house for your money and a chance to stretch your budget further, allowing you to enjoy the slower pace of life that the South is famous for. You'll find yourself with disposable income to spend on enjoying the local cuisine, exploring nearby outdoor attractions, or simply relaxing on your porch with a sweet tea. From an investment perspective, Bessemer presents a compelling opportunity, especially for first-time homebuyers or those looking to downsize. While the median household income of $34,953 is lower than the national average, the cost of living is significantly lower, making homeownership attainable. The market is driven by affordability, making it attractive to those seeking a solid investment with the potential for appreciation. Bessemer is perfect for families and retirees looking for a welcoming community and a chance to experience the charm of the South without breaking the bank.
